From: Markus Stockhausen Date: Sun, 11 Jan 2026 13:43:07 +0000 (+0100) Subject: realtek: rt-loader: fix chip revision printout X-Git-Url: http://git.ipfire.org/cgi-bin/gitweb.cgi?a=commitdiff_plain;h=168f5609aff27b1db87b7fa79717a3271f02f83a;p=thirdparty%2Fopenwrt.git realtek: rt-loader: fix chip revision printout There is currently a mismatch in the detection of the chip type. rt-loader and the kernel give different revisions. E.g. rt-loader: Running on RTL9313 (chip id 6567A) with 256MB kernel: Realtek RTL9313 rev B (6567) SoC with 256 MB Realtek internal version numbering is - for RTL838x: 1=A, 2=B, ... - for others: 0=A, 1=B, ... rt-loader does not differentiate that. Adapt the calculation to give a consistent picture.
